Given the expression:  (4z^8)^{-3}

Use exponent rules;

(ab)^m = a^m \cdot b^m

(a^m)^n = a^{mn}

Apply the rules in the given expression we get;

(4z^8)^{-3}

⇒4^{-3} \cdot (z^8)^{-3}

⇒\frac{1}{4^3} \cdot z^{-24}

⇒\frac{1}{64}z^{-24}

Therefore, the correct  Mario simplified form of the given expression is \frac{1}{64}z^{-24}
